66-million-year-old dinosaur eggs found near the South Pole

Arabia.net – Researchers have discovered hundreds of fragments of dinosaur eggshells near the South Pole, laid approximately 66 million years ago in the far south of Patagonia, Argentina.
The study, published in the journal Royal Society Open Science, indicates that a team led by Japanese paleontologist Kohei Tanaka from the University of Tsukuba discovered more than 250 pieces of large dinosaur eggshells within the Chorrillo rock formation, dating to the Late Cretaceous period in southern Patagonia.
